The Indians did the same once, on a religous basis. In the early 1840s the Sikh's in a Kingdom called the Sutlej (somewhere in India), raised an army of nearly 100,000 troops, trained to perfection and the biggest threat to British dominance in Asia and the subcontinent. This Army fought against the British in the First Sikh War (1845-1846), they got their assess handed to them by seriously inferior numbers of British troops, although some say the Sikh Commander's fouled up their attacks on purpose as they did not want to destroy British India, as the radical Sikh's would simply rampage through Asia and nothing would be left. But anyway, around 5000 Sikh troops managed to escape from the British on several fronts and were headed back to the Sutlej, probably to kill the 8 year old Dalip Singh (the Maharaj) and his Mother who was in effective control. So they brought in an Indian Muslim regiment from rear guard duty to protect the royal family- the Hindu's never attacked them and the Sikh Army disintegrated.
Long story short, Indian Army used religiously different troops in the same way the people in Singapore use Nepalese troops.

Of course, fear is also a factor- Taliban and Iraqi insurgents are more scared of Pakistani SOF and Intel forces than anyone else. Equally in the 1980s Libya created an Islamic Pan-African Legion from dissidents in Sudan, Egypt, Tunisia, Mali and Chad, scared people in North Africa, Europe and America over what they were possible of, especially with Syrian instructors. The Libyan Military Intelligence Force (MIF) also, apparently, scare the shit out of terrorists in the Middle East, they and the Pakistani's are the two people that Insurgents from Iraq and Afghanistan do not want to end up dealing with.

Bjorn: You could put orange polka-dots on if you want. There really isn't anything saying that a country's kit has to match the flag. Holland has orange jerseys, which originate from the former royal House of Orange; Croatia has a cool jersey with a red and white checkerboard pattern that is found only in their coat of arms; Australia has yellow jerseys and green shorts...and neither of those colours are in their flag.

I suppose the only question you might ask yourself is what would my nation's kit look like if designed by Nike, or Umbro, or Adidas? After that, it just a matter of putting the colours in. Details could include numbering, and a national soccer/football association logo could go over the heart and on the shorts. Soccer kits don't have home and away like most professional sports. They have official colours that they wear all the time, except when it might clash with a home team (home teams get first choice of which kit they want to wear). The other kit is a reserve kit that is fairly distinct from the official.

You can get a great look at all the kits at the official World Cup (http://fifaworldcup.yahoo.com/) site.
